S.B. 260 - Judiciary Appropriations Act of 2025

  • Appropriates funds to the Hawaii judiciary for the fiscal biennium July 1, 2025 through June 30, 2027 from general funds (A), special funds (B), general obligation bonds (C), federal funds (N), and revolving funds (W).

  • Allocates operating appropriations to Courts of Appeal ($9.6-9.7 million), First Circuit ($98.1-98.3 million), Second Circuit ($20.2 million), Third Circuit ($24.9 million), Fifth Circuit ($9.2 million), Judicial Selection Commission ($114,074), and Administration ($42-42.2 million).

  • Appropriates $1 million per fiscal year from general funds for civil legal services and directs the judiciary to study expungement procedures for partial convictions, submitting findings to the legislature by 40 days before the 2026 regular session.

  • Authorizes $11.9 million in general obligation bonds for capital improvement projects including plans and design for a South Kohala judiciary complex ($4 million), air conditioning systems replacement in Kauai ($900,000), and statewide facility alterations and improvements ($7 million).

  • Effective July 1, 2025; allows the chief justice to transfer funds and positions between programs as needed and provides flexibility for managing capital improvement projects.
